Be on the Lookout for These Late-Season AC Repairs
Homeowners associate the need for AC repairs or maintenance with summer weather. It makes sense; your AC works hard those months and could have a higher chance of needing some professional attention. But you don’t want to switch your AC off and forget it for a whole year, especially if you think your AC could use a repair.
If it’s getting into the fall months and you’re dealing with any of these problems, a late-season air conditioning repair in Cherry Hill, NJ, could be what you’re looking for.
You’re Noticing Utility Costs Creeping Higher
If you’re reaching the tail end of August with a noticeably higher energy bill than in May, your AC may need looking at. If parts are broken or damaged, your efficiency could be at risk, and leaving that repair for next year when the hot weather appears won’t do anything but cost you more – in energy costs and likely a repair bill as well.
You’re Not Feeling Quite as Cool Anymore
The last few weeks of summer and the first few of autumn can be confusing for an AC. One day, you feel like you’ll need it, and the next day, you’ll have the windows open.
But if you’re still running your AC, and your home isn’t staying cool, even with the lower outdoor temperatures, that could be cause for concern. It’s another problem that won’t go away if you ignore it over winter and could even worsen if you don’t call for air conditioning repair in Cherry Hill, NJ, to get it handled.
You’re Caught Off-Guard by Unseasonably Warm Weather
If you’ve been hoping to push your AC through August, praying that cool weather will come so you can ignore the problem, you may not be so lucky. If you’re hit with warm weather in September or October, your already-damaged AC parts could strain more, causing more damage.
